Imagine two Python apps of which one needs libBar 1.0 and another libBar 2.0.Ī virtualenv solves this problem cleverly by creating an isolated environment. This is unlike other programming languages that don’t install modules system wide. That can become an issue if programs need different versions of the same module. Python by default install modules system wide. Virtualenv can create isolated Python environments.
